How Outpatient Drug Treatment Works in Bowmansville, New York

If you have been battling with an extreme substance use disorder and addiction, outpatient drug and alcohol rehab might not prove suitable for you. Before you seek treatment for your condition, you must first go through detox to rid your body completely of the substances you were abusing.

After the detox stage, the outpatient alcohol and drug rehab program will begin the real work of therapy and recovery. In fact, these programs work better if you have already completed another form of care - such as a participating in an inpatient alcohol and drug treatment facility. You should also be deemed medically stable enough that you can comfortably pursue treatment and recovery without the need of constant monitoring.

When you enroll in an outpatient alcohol and drug rehabilitation program in Bowmansville, the following services will be provided every week:

  • Family therapy sessions
  • Group therapy and support meetings
  • One-on-one therapy session
  • Organization and management of prescribed medications for co-occurring disorders
  • Diet Management
  • One on one therapy sessions with licensed treatment counselors
  • Exercise related therapy
  • Training in relapse prevention techniques
  • Sober living housing, where required

Since outpatient treatment does not demand that you live inside the facility, it means that you might need to dedicate yourself to sobriety so that the program proves fruitful in the long run. You should also strive for sobriety and abstain from drugs without any supervision or assistance.

As long as your environment is conducive to your recovery, you may find that outpatient alcohol and drug treatment is the best option. This is because you will get help and assistance at home so that you can continue focusing on overcoming your addiction - with none of the pitfalls you may have run into in the past.
